Do you need a fishing license in Illinois right now?

A license is required for fishing in all Illinois waters, including lakes, reservoirs, rivers and streams . Licenses are not required for anglers who are under the age of 16, blind or disabled anglers, or residents on active military service.

Do you need a trout stamp in Illinois?

All anglers, including those who intend to release fish caught before April 2, must have a fishing license and an Inland Trout Stamp, unless they are under the age of 16, blind or disabled, or are an Illinois resident on leave from active duty in the Armed Forces. The daily catch limit for each angler is five trout.

Do veterans need a fishing license in Illinois?

In recognition of the services of Illinois resident veterans, the Department of Natural Resources will issue veterans a current fishing license, sportsmen's combination license or hunting license at one-half the current fee .

How many hooks can you fish with in Illinois?

Section 810.20 Snagging

a) Sport fishermen are permitted only one pole and line device to which can be attached no more than two hooks . On the Mississippi River between Illinois and Iowa, the maximum treble hook size is 5/0; gaffs may not be used to land paddlefish.

Can you keep paddlefish in Illinois?

Section 810.20 Snagging

Every paddlefish snagged must be included in the daily harvest limit . Every salmon 10 inches in total length or longer snagged must be taken into immediate possession and included in the daily harvest limit. Once the daily limit of salmon or paddlefish has been reached, snagging must cease.

Is hand fishing legal in Illinois?

For these obvious reasons, the num- ber of Illinois fishermen who employ hand fishing is relatively small compared with other fishing methods. But it's a perfectly legal practice on waters where wading is allowed and where site regulations do not prohibit such activity .

Are fish traps legal in Illinois?

Except as provided in Section 20-25, it is unlawful to use any basket trap other than a basket trap constructed of wood or plastic slats . A legal trap must have an unobstructed opening or openings in the rear end of the trap not less than 1 1/2 inches square.
